Section 12-5-523 - Cooperation with Water Council; involvement of stakeholders; initial draft plan

Ask AI about this
(a) The division shall work in cooperation, coordination, and communication with the Water Council and any other state, local, regional, or federal agency as appropriate to develop a comprehensive state-wide water management plan.(b) The division shall solicit extensive stakeholder involvement in the development of the proposed plan. Such stakeholders shall include, without limitation, other state agencies, nonprofit advocacy organizations, business organizations, local government entities and associations of local government entities, and regional commissions.(c) The division shall submit a draft initial comprehensive state-wide water management plan to the Water Council for review no later than July 1, 2007.Amended by 2008 Ga. Laws 436,§ 19, eff. 7/1/2009.Amended by 2005 Ga. Laws 19,§ 12, eff. 4/7/2005.Added by 2004 Ga. Laws 571, § 2, eff. 5/13/2004.Former § 12-5-523 was repealed by 2004 Ga. Laws 571, § 2, eff. 5/13/2004.
